Design and synthesis of hydrophobic and chiral anions from amino acids as precursor for functional ionic liquids

Abstract

Hydrophobic ionic liquids composed of tetrabutylphosphonium cation and chiral anions derived from amino acids modified with trifluoromethane sulfonyl groups have been synthesized using a simple method.
